Draft letter from Margaret Pearse to Father [Michael O'Flanagan] concerning the financial difficulties facing St. Enda's School and suggesting she visit the United States to encourage donations,

circa 1923.
Bibliographic Details
Main Creator: Pearse, Margaret, 1857-1932
Contributors: O'Flanagan, Michael, 1876-1942
Summary:Margaret Pearse writes "If you or Fr. [Michael] Hannan think my presence would help you in any way I am quite willing to face the jounrey, that is the least I might do". Margaret Pearse toured the United States in 1924.
